Why This Cover Letter Works in 2025
Industry Experience
In this cover letter, the candidate demonstrates their experience in different areas of the makeup industry. This makes them stand out as a versatile and well-rounded artist who can adapt to various projects and challenges.
Quantifiable Achievements
Quantifying achievements, like increasing client satisfaction and growing the company's clientele, provides concrete evidence of the candidate's skills and expertise. This makes their accomplishments more impactful and convincing to the hiring manager.
Excitement for Role
Expressing genuine excitement for the specific aspects of the role, such as working on product launches and promotional events, shows that the candidate has thoroughly researched the company and is truly passionate about the position. This makes their application more memorable and engaging.
